SSO認証基盤構築・開発・保守サービス(Keycloak)

Keycloakを用いたSSO認証基盤の構築・開発・保守サービス

オープンソース・ソフトウェアのKeycloakを利用した、シングルサインオン(SSO)*1の認証基盤の構築・開発・保守サービスを提供いたします。
当社が持つKeycloakに関する知識やノウハウを生かして、以下の特徴を持つシステムの構築が可能です。

  •  Keycloakにアカウントを追加するだけで、すべてのWEBサービスが利用可能
  •  2台の冗長構成のシステムの構築
  •  お客様のご要望に沿った認証機能の追加開発
  •  Keycloakが持つ既存の機能のカスタマイズ
  •  ID/パスワード認証以外の認証が可能 (ワンタイムパスワード認証など)
  •  運用時の不具合の原因調査・改善などのリモート保守
  •  ログメッセージ、リソースなどのシステム監視
keycloakbg
listyle
listylecheck3

*1 シングルサインオン(SSO)とは 1つのアカウントにログインするだけで、ログインが必要な複数のWEBサービスなどを利用できるようになる仕組みのことです。

 


サービス利用イメージ

サービス提供イメージ

  当社内での取り組み

当社の社内システムを、Keycloakを使ってSSOに対応させました。
社員は下記の様々な社内サービスを一つのアカウントで利用しています。

  • Drupal8 (会社サイト)
    社内向けの機能を利用可能 (社内向け機能については、会社サイト構築サービスをご覧ください)
  • RocketChat (社内チャット)
    社員同士のチャットが可能
  • GitBucket (ソース管理)
    開発したソースコードの管理が可能
  • Amazon Web Service
    Keycloakのアカウントを利用して、AWSへのログインが可能
    社員ごとに利用できるAWSのサービスを制限することが可能
  • メールサーバ 
    Keycloakのアカウントを利用して、メールクライアントからメール送受信が可能
  • Rainloop WebMail
    Keycloakのアカウントを利用して、WEBメールの送受信が可能

 

 

keycloak図